As we continue our journey toward becoming Irelands most trusted and sustainable business, we are looking for a Head of IT Finance to help drive our ambitious growth strategy. This is an exciting opportunity to support transformative IT initiatives that will shape the future of our business, enabling us to scale and innovate in new ways. This role is suited to an individual who is a qualified accountant, enjoys a fast-paced environment, is comfortable in building and managing relationships at senior/executive level and has an interest in how IT transformation will shape the future of the business. What you`ll be doing: Leading and developing a small team of finance professionals (3 including this role) Sitting as a member of the IT Leadership Team Business partnering to the Chief Technology Officer and the senior IT leadership team across the Group Working with the wider business, including Retail, Wholesale and Supply Chain, provide decision support and investment analysis in respect of IT transformation projects across the Group Support the Transformation Office in the assessment of project related benefits and post investment reviews Lead the Forecast, Budget and 3-year plan process for IT opex and capex spend Oversee the management of monthly, quarterly and year end cost reporting for the IT function versus budget - delivering analysis, insight, and decision support to the business Identifying process improvement opportunities across all areas of IT Finance including reporting and cost allocation methodologies. Where applicable, identify where these opportunities may extend to other areas of Finance Ensuring adherence to internal and external financial governance and risk management on behalf of finance for IT, including appropriate cost capitalisation in line with accounting standards Provide ad hoc decision support to the Chief Technology Officer and Finance Director as required Support the senior finance team to deliver the One Finance and transformation strategy. What we are looking for: Be a qualified accountant with a minimum of 10 years PQE Exceptional team leadership and communication skills and a proven ability to influence at a senior level Comfortable dealing with large capex portfolios and the governance/financial management of same Experience in business partnering across a large organization and working with these partners on business cases and investment appraisals Strong systems orientation, ability to navigate IT environments and experience in change management A strategic and curious mindset capable of challenging with a view to delivering the optimal outcome Confident analytical, presentation and communication skills (both verbal and written) Excellent self-discipline and organisational skills Adaptability and flexibility to work effectively within different situations and with multiple projects, teams, and individuals An understanding of modern IT delivery models (agile, cloud, SaaS) and their financial impacts would be an advantage but is not a prerequisite What we Offer: Career Development: With a commitment to your personal and professional growth, Musgrave offers numerous opportunities for advancement and learning Collaborative Environment: Work alongside a passionate team, where your contributions will make a significant impact Innovation Focus: Be part of a company that values forward-thinking solutions Community Focus: Be part of a company that truly values its communities and strives to make a positive impact.
